The Crown has tendered also other evidence to

which objection is here taken, the same objection having

been taken already at the trial. This evidence was

received and submitted to the jury in support of the

indictment. It was derived from the witnesses Zimmern and

Christie and falls into two sections. In the first

section it was stated that on the 20th Xạr h the accused

invited Zimmern to bring his friends to dinner. The

accused met Zi mern, Christie and two other men that

evening at the Ye Fong Chan restaurant. At this restaurant

the accused invited Zi-mern and his party to go with him

to the Mathm Hotd there and then to assault Fung. They

went to the Nathm Hɔtel arriving on the 31st March

between 1 a.m. and 2 s.a.

accused at this time was

The avowed object of the

*save his own face" by smacking

Fung's face. Fung did not leave his rʊom and the assault

did not take place.
